Shading and Cross-Hatching in Patent Drawings: Proper Use

Shading and cross-hatching play a critical role in patent drawings. They are not decorative elements; rather, they are technical tools used to clearly convey the structure, depth, contours, and material distinctions of an invention. When applied correctly, they enhance clarity and support patentability. When misapplied, they can lead to objections, redraw requests, or even rejection by patent offices.

What Is Shading in Patent Drawings?

Shading is used to represent surface contours, curvature, and three-dimensional form in patent drawings. It helps examiners understand the spatial relationship between elements, especially in mechanical, industrial design, and consumer product inventions.

Key Rules for Shading

  • Shading must be light, uniform, and consistent
  • It should never obscure reference numerals or lead lines
  • It must not interfere with the clarity of edges or outlines
  • Excessive shading that affects legibility is not permitted

Shading is commonly used in:

  • Design patent drawings
  • Perspective views
  • Drawings where depth or curvature is essential to understanding the invention

What Is Cross-Hatching in Patent Drawings?

Cross-hatching consists of parallel lines used primarily in sectional views to indicate cut surfaces. It may also be used to distinguish different materials when required.

Standard Cross-Hatching Guidelines

  • Lines are generally drawn at approximately 45°
  • Spacing must be even and consistent
  • Hatch lines must not cross or touch reference numerals
  • Adjacent parts should not share identical hatching if they represent different components or materials

Cross-hatching is especially important in:

  • Sectional views
  • Mechanical and industrial inventions
  • Drawings requiring material differentiation

USPTO Requirements for Shading and Cross-Hatching

Under 37 C.F.R. § 1.84, the USPTO allows shading and cross-hatching provided they meet strict clarity requirements.

USPTO Best Practices

  • Cross-hatching in sectional views should be uniform and angled consistently
  • Different materials may be shown using distinct hatch patterns, if necessary
  • Shading must not obscure reference characters
  • Line quality must remain reproducible in black and white

Evolving USPTO Practice (2025)

The USPTO is gradually becoming more flexible:

  • Limited acceptance of color drawings in specific cases
  • Consideration of supplemental formats (e.g., 3D models) where appropriate

However, black-and-white line drawings remain the safest and most widely accepted standard.

EPO Requirements and Recent Updates

EPO Update (Effective 1 October 2025)

The European Patent Office now allows color and grayscale drawings when filed electronically, provided that:

  • The drawings are clear and reproducible
  • Resolution and formatting requirements are met
  • Color is essential to understanding the invention

Despite this update, black-and-white drawings remain the preferred and safest approach in most EPO filings, especially for technical inventions.

EPO Best Practices

  • Shading should be used sparingly and only where necessary
  • Cross-hatching must be clear and consistent
  • Excessive tonal variation should be avoided
  • All elements must remain easily reproducible in monochrome formats

International (PCT/WIPO) Considerations

Under WIPO drawing standards, shading and cross-hatching are permitted but must:

  • Be clear when reproduced in black and white
  • Not interfere with reference numerals
  • Follow consistent patterns throughout the drawing set

Because PCT applications may enter multiple national phases, conservative and standardized drawing practices are strongly recommended.

Common Mistakes to Avoid

  • Over-shading that reduces clarity
  • Hatching that overlaps reference numerals
  • Inconsistent hatch angles across views
  • Using shading for decorative purposes
  • Mixing shading and hatching without a clear intent
  • Using color when it is not essential

These errors frequently result in office actions or redraw requests, increasing both time and cost.

Best-Practice Checklist for Patent Drawings

  • Use shading only to convey depth or curvature
  • Keep hatch lines at consistent angles and spacing
  • Ensure all numerals remain fully legible
  • Maintain uniform style across all figures
  • Follow jurisdiction-specific requirements
  • When in doubt, choose clarity over aesthetics
